I will stay away from audio house. You are actually buying the "free gifts" from them and eventually realised the gifts are useless.

The flash...about $30
The 8 GB card about $35 (low speed)
Filter - $6 (no multi coating, produce bad flare)
Cleaning Kit $5 (some tissue and solution or a cheapo blower)
Card reader $10
3rd party batt $28 (Can't tell the charge level on camera)
Their tripod....those plastic $30 tripod
Small Dry Cab....less then $80

The freebies worth it? You might use it once or twice to realise that they are actually useless. And the earn super high margin through those freebies that you buy!

$1799 for Kit 2 is the SRP shown on Canon's website. Current Canon promo comes with Crumpler bag (with Canon logo on bag & EOS on shoulder pad) plus a 8GB class 4 card. You might not want all the other freebies & get it cheaper than $1799. I paid $1650 a month ago, without freebies apart from Canon promo gifts; I thought I've paid too much after reading the threads in this forum. As for the Flash, there are advantages in buying a compatible Canon EX series flash separately later when you need one. I've been advised by many not to start buying extras until I use it for a while & evaluate what I need to add on systematically. Rgds
